Cardinals | Skipping Michael Wacha
St. Louis Cardinals SP Michael Wacha (rest) will have his next start skipped so he can receive extra rest. RP Carlos Martínez will make the spot start for Wacha Sunday, June 22.  Source: MLB.com - Jenifer Langosch
 
BHQ take: STL may be saying, "Nothing to see here," but Wacha has seen a dropoff in Ks and swinging strikes over the last month. In his last six starts, his Dom was 5.3 (9.0 in 2013) and SwK% 8% (12% in 2013), including three outings of two K or fewer.
